Morning: Start your day with a stroll along the Promenade Beach, also known as the Rock Beach. Enjoy the fresh sea breeze and the sound of waves crashing on the shore. If you're lucky, you might spot some dolphins.
Afternoon: After a quick lunch at one of the many street food vendors nearby, visit the War Memorial. This monument commemorates the French soldiers who died in World War I.
Evening: As the sun sets, head to the Light House. Climb up to the top for a panoramic view of the city and the sea. Don't forget to carry your camera to capture the stunning sunset.
Morning: Have a leisurely breakfast and then head to Auroville, an experimental township. Visit the Matrimandir, a golden dome that serves as the spiritual and physical center of Auroville. Take a walk around the beautiful gardens.
Afternoon: Enjoy lunch at one of Auroville's many unique cafes, such as Bread & Chocolate or the Auroville Bakery. Afterward, explore the Botanical Garden, which houses a variety of exotic flora and fauna.
Evening: End your day with a visit to the Basilica of the Sacred Heart of Jesus. This impressive church features neo-Gothic architecture and stunning stained glass windows.
In addition to the above itinerary, you may also want to consider visiting the French Quarter for a taste of European architecture and culture. You can also take a side trip to Mahabalipuram,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its ancient rock-cut temples and monuments. For maximum fun, try renting a bike and exploring the city on two wheels. Don't forget to try the local cuisine, especially the seafood and French-inspired dishes.
